The global Oat-Based Snacks market refers to food products made primarily from oats, designed for convenient consumption. These snacks can be found in various forms such as oat bars, oat cookies, oat cakes, and other processed foods, all designed to offer a combination of health benefits and taste. Oat-based snacks are often marketed as healthier alternatives to traditional processed snacks due to oats' nutritional profile, which includes high fiber, protein, and a variety of essential minerals.
Oats, a popular whole grain, are often incorporated into snacks to promote heart health, weight management, and digestive health. With the increasing global demand for healthier, on-the-go snack options, oat-based snacks have become a favored choice among health-conscious consumers. The market includes both traditional oat snacks and newer innovations, such as savory oat-based snacks, catering to a broad consumer base across different demographics.
The global Oat-Based Snacks market was valued at USD 14,060 million in 2024 and is projected to grow to USD 18,996.35 million by 2032, ex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.40% during the forecast period.
The North American market for oat-based snacks was estimated at USD 3,880.28 million in 2024 and is expected to experience steady growth at a CAGR of 2.91% from 2025 through 2032. This steady growth is largely driven by the growing preference for healthier snacks and the increasing awareness of the health benefits of oats.
This growth is fueled by consumer shifts towards better-for-you foods, the rising popularity of plant-based diets, and the growing availability of oat-based snack products in both retail and online channels.
Drivers:
Health Conscious Consumer Trends: The growing consumer demand for healthier, natural, and plant-based snacks is one of the main drivers for the oat-based snacks market. Oats are rich in fiber, vitamins, and minerals, making them an attractive option for health-conscious consumers who are looking for nutritious and convenient snacks.
Rising Popularity of Plant-Based and Vegan Diets: As more people adopt plant-based and vegan lifestyles, the demand for oat-based snacks increases. Oats are naturally vegan, and many oat-based snack products are marketed as dairy-free, which aligns with the preferences of these consumer groups.
Increase in Convenience Foods: The growing demand for on-the-go snacks that require little to no preparation time has boosted the oat-based snack segment. Oat-based products such as bars and cookies are seen as convenient and portable meal or snack replacements, appealing to busy, health-conscious individuals.
Oats as a Functional Ingredient: Oats are recognized for their health benefits, including lowering cholesterol levels, aiding digestion, and providing long-lasting energy. These functional attributes are increasingly being marketed by snack producers, positioning oat-based snacks as a nutritious choice.
Restraints:
Price Sensitivity: While oat-based snacks are often marketed as premium products due to their perceived health benefits, their higher price point compared to traditional snacks can be a deterrent for some consumers. The cost factor can limit widespread adoption in price-sensitive markets.
Competition from Other Healthy Snacks: The market for healthy snacks is crowded with numerous alternatives, such as protein bars, fruit-based snacks, and other whole grain options. Oat-based snacks face significant competition from these alternatives, which can limit growth potential.
Supply Chain Challenges: The production of oat-based snacks is subject to fluctuations in the supply of oats, which are affected by factors like climate change, crop yield variations, and global demand. These supply chain challenges can impact pricing and availability.
Opportunities:
Product Innovation: Companies have an opportunity to innovate within the oat-based snacks market by introducing new flavors, textures, and formats. Oat-based savory snacks, in particular, represent an untapped segment with significant growth potential.
Growing Emerging Markets: Developing markets, especially in Asia-Pacific and Latin America, present a significant opportunity for oat-based snacks. With rising incomes and increasing health awareness, these regions are likely to see strong demand for healthier snack options in the coming years.
Sustainability Trends: As consumers become more environmentally conscious, brands that prioritize sustainable sourcing of oats and packaging materials can tap into the growing demand for eco-friendly products. Companies with strong sustainability credentials are expected to have a competitive advantage.
Challenges:
Consumer Education: Despite the growing popularity of oat-based snacks, many consumers still perceive oats primarily as a breakfast food. Educating consumers about the versatility of oats and their suitability as a snack could help expand the market further.
Regulatory Compliance: Oat-based snack manufacturers must navigate the complex regulatory landscape regarding food labeling, health claims, and ingredient sourcing, which can impact product formulations and marketing strategies.
North America
The North American market for oat-based snacks is expected to remain strong throughout the forecast period. The U.S., in particular, represents a key market due to the high demand for health-conscious and convenience food products. In addition, the growing number of vegan, gluten-free, and plant-based diet adopters in the region contributes significantly to the market's expansion.
Canada and Mexico also show promising growth due to rising health awareness and the increasing availability of oat-based snacks in mainstream grocery stores and online platforms.
Europe
Europe is another key market, driven by the demand for healthy snacks, particularly in countries such as the U.K., Germany, and France. The trend of healthy eating and snacking, particularly among younger consumers, is likely to continue driving growth. In addition, the strong tradition of oats consumption in Scandinavian countries provides a solid foundation for the market.
Asia-Pacific
The Asia-Pacific market is poised for significant growth, largely driven by emerging economies such as China and India, where changing dietary patterns and increasing disposable incomes are creating demand for healthier snack options. Oat-based snacks' popularity is expected to rise, particularly in urban areas, where busy lifestyles and health concerns are driving demand for convenient, nutritious snack options.
South America
The South American market for oat-based snacks is expected to grow steadily, with Brazil and Argentina emerging as the leading countries in terms of consumption. As health-conscious eating becomes more mainstream in these regions, the demand for oat-based snacks is likely to increase.
Middle East & Africa
In the Middle East and Africa, oat-based snacks are gaining popularity, especially in countries like Saudi Arabia and the UAE, where affluent consumers are driving the demand for premium, health-focused snack options.
